Home Delivery

Home Delivery


Are you homebound due to age or a medical condition?  Do you love to read but are no longer able to commute to the Library?

Home delivery is a convenient service that supplies books, large print books, audiobooks, magazines, music, and movies to City of Friendswood residents who are unable to use the library due to temporary or long-term physical and medical disabilities.

A Friendswood Public Library staff member will deliver library materials to your home and pick up the materials for return on scheduled days.

Friends of the Library

Love The Library?


Become a Friend of Friendswood Library for as little as a $10 annual membership.  The Friends meet the first Tuesday of the month for an hour to discuss service initiatives, outreach, and fundraising activities.  Meetings are optional but the Friends would love to hear from you.  Become a Friend online through the Friendswood Library website or in person at the library’s circulation desk. 

The Friends have helped the Friendswood Library obtain library equipment such as a portable document scanner, Oculus Rift Virtual Reality System, a display case, Wi-Fi Hot Spots, and prizes for Summer Reading. The Friends also sponsor many library programs and events throughout the year including ZakiCon, May the Fourth Be With You, the Ekphrastic Poetry Contest, music performances, and others.
